    The Awfulizer: Learning to Overcome the Shame Game, author Kristin Maher gives shame a name and face, showing just how real and big it can be for children; how it keeps them feeling isolated and alone, and makes them question their self-worth. I feel like there is a monster in my head. And all he does is say awful things to me. He tells me all the things I am doing wrong and how I am wrong, and it makes me sad and scared. Shame is a powerful emotion for children, and when they get sucked into the Shame Game and start believing lies about themselves that they don't just MAKE mistakes, but they ARE a mistake their world can become a dark place.
    Summary: 
    James' life changes the day he meets the Awfulizer, a strange monster who follows him everywhere, reminding him about all his mistakes and shortcomings. But after a talk with his parents, James begins to feel better about himself. Includes parent/teacher tips.
